Pressure Cooker is a nine-piece reggae, ska, and rocksteady band from Boston, Massachusetts, formed in 1997. They specialize in original music that faithfully recreates the styles of 1960s and 70s Jamaican music, featuring a prominent horn section and a rhythm section dedicated to danceable grooves. The band has released multiple albums and performed extensively across the US.
